Hey did you miss the game? Yeah, they played it already! K-State and KU both in the top five played two overtimes before a winner was established. And what a game! K-State had already lost once to KU and now they had to go to Allen Field House where they were met by 17,000 screaming fans.

Before the game K-State’s coach had a dream. He came up with the perfect way to defend KU’s big center, a huge guy who literally seemed to occupy the entire center of the court. In his dream K-State completely stifled the big guy by putting forwards at the big guy’s “belt buckle” and at each of his shoulders, then depended on the guards to zone the other guys on the team. The K-State coach told his team, “The big dude doesn’t go to the bathroom without this triangle around him!”
